Question
which sentence explains why polygon abcdefgh is congruent to polygon mnopqrst?
a. a sequence of translations will map mnopqrst onto abcdefgh.
b. a sequence of rigid transformations will map mnopqrst onto abcdefgh.
c. a sequence of rotations will map mnopqrst onto abcdefgh.
d. a sequence of reflections will map mnopqrst onto abcdefgh.
To determine why the polygons are congruent, we recall the definition of congruent polygons: they can be mapped onto each other using rigid transformations (translations, rotations, reflections), which preserve side lengths and angles.
- Option A: Translations alone may not be sufficient as the orientation might differ.
- Option B: Rigid transformations (translations, rotations, reflections) can map one polygon onto the other because rigid transformations preserve congruence (side lengths and angles remain the same).
- Option C: Rotations alone may not align the polygons correctly without other transformations.
- Option D: Reflections alone may not be enough, and the key is that any rigid transformation (not just reflections) can be used.
So the correct reasoning is that a sequence of rigid transformations will map one polygon onto the other.
